THE MAGIC GANG The EP is out! Are you happy with how it has been received? We are! More than anything we’re looking forward to playing the songs live now that people are familiar with them. What’s with the synchronised swimming in the video for ‘Feeling Better’? We just felt the song sounded like it needed a dance routine, so why not a swimming dance routine?! You played the big room at the Roundhouse supporting Swim Deep back last year, how was that? It was amazing. Playing the venue lived up to our expectations, and the people in the audience made it really special.

BENICÀSSIM
14th - 17th July Muse, Hinds, Disclosure and The Vaccines are among the latest names for the Spanish bash, joining the alreadyannounced Kendrick Lamar, Major Lazer, The Maccabees and Jamie xx.
LOVEBOX
15th - 16th July LCD Soundsystem and Major Lazer headline this year’s Victoria Park twodayer, the former a “London exclusive”. Among those also appearing are MØ, Run The Jewels, Jungle, Jack Garratt, and Stormzy.
LONGITUDE
15th - 17th July Kendrick Lamar, Major Lazer and The National have been announced as headliners, with Jamie xx, Chvrches, Courtney Barnett, MØ, Tyler, The Creator, Róisín Murphy, A$AP Ferg and Father John Misty also playing.
SECRET GARDEN PARTY
21st - 24th July Caribou and Air join Primal Scream as headliner, with Swim Deep, The Japanese House, Dua Lipa, Rae Morris and Oscar also confirmed.
KENDAL CALLING
28th - 31st July Noel Gallagher’s High Flying Birds, Everything Everything and Rat Boy are among the first artists announced, with The Charlatans, Hooton Tennis Club, The Hives and The Big Moon also playing.
ØYA
9th - 13th August
FIDLAR and The Last Shadow Puppets have been added to a line-up that already features PJ Harvey, Chvrches, Stormzy and Jamie xx.
BOARDMASTERS
10th - 14th August Deadmau5 is the second headliner announced for the Cornish surf-loving weekend, with Primal Scream, Rat Boy and Mystery Jets joining acts including the previously-confirmed Wolf Alice, Kaiser Chiefs and VANT.
WAY OUT WEST
11th - 13th August Skepta, Massive Attack and Young Fathers and Jack Garratt join the likes of Chvrches, Jamie xx, Sia, Stormzy, and The Last Shadow Puppets in Gothenburg this August.
